Description

1) [Rohm & Haas] A brand name for an oil modified alkyd resin used as a base for paints.

2) [CTD] A U.S. Trademark for a complex cyclodextrin product. Aquaplex is a polysaccharide that is soluble in water, ethanol, and methanol. Methylated and ethylated versions are soluble in organic solvents.
